Drivers Propelling Market Expansion

One of the primary dynamics propelling the rainscreen cladding market is the global surge in construction activity, particularly in urban centers. Rising demand for commercial, residential, and institutional buildings necessitates advanced façade solutions that not only enhance aesthetics but also improve building performance. Rainscreen cladding systems fulfill this need by providing superior protection against weather elements, thermal insulation, and durability.

Sustainability initiatives and stricter building codes focused on energy efficiency are accelerating the adoption of rainscreen systems. Governments worldwide are implementing regulations that mandate energy-saving materials and methods, compelling builders and architects to incorporate rainscreen cladding into their designs. This regulatory push creates a sustained demand base for the market.

Technological innovation also plays a pivotal role. The introduction of lightweight materials, improved fastening techniques, and integration with digital tools such as Building Information Modeling (BIM) enhances product appeal and installation efficiency. These advancements reduce labor costs, speed up construction timelines, and ensure better quality control.

Restraints and Challenges Impacting Growth

Despite promising growth drivers, the rainscreen cladding market faces several challenges that could hamper expansion. High initial installation costs compared to traditional façade systems may deter budget-conscious developers, especially in price-sensitive markets. While the long-term benefits in terms of energy savings and durability justify investment, upfront expenses remain a hurdle.

Raw material price volatility is another significant restraint. Many rainscreen components rely on materials such as aluminum, fiber cement, or advanced composites, whose prices can fluctuate due to supply chain disruptions or geopolitical factors. Such variability complicates pricing strategies and may reduce profit margins.

Labor shortages and the requirement for skilled installers capable of handling complex rainscreen systems pose additional challenges. The technical nature of installation demands specialized training, and in some regions, the scarcity of qualified personnel can delay projects and increase costs.

Opportunities for Market Growth

The rainscreen cladding market presents multiple avenues for growth amid these challenges. Emerging economies with rapidly expanding urban infrastructure offer untapped potential. As governments invest in modernization and smart city projects, demand for innovative façade solutions is expected to rise significantly.

Retrofit and renovation projects in mature markets constitute another growth opportunity. Older buildings seeking energy upgrades or aesthetic improvements increasingly adopt rainscreen cladding due to its minimal impact on structural integrity and enhanced insulation capabilities.

Sustainability-focused product development presents a promising avenue. Manufacturers investing in eco-friendly materials, recyclable panels, and energy-efficient systems can differentiate themselves and appeal to environmentally conscious consumers. Certification schemes like LEED and BREEAM further incentivize the adoption of green building products.

Competitive Landscape and Market Evolution

The competitive dynamics within the rainscreen cladding market are evolving rapidly. Companies are increasingly focusing on R&D to develop proprietary materials and patented fastening systems that provide performance advantages. Strategic partnerships and acquisitions help expand geographic reach and product portfolios, enabling firms to better serve diverse client needs.

Digital transformation is also reshaping the market. The use of BIM and virtual reality tools facilitates accurate design, customization, and clash detection, reducing rework and costs. Manufacturers offering integrated digital services alongside physical products are gaining a competitive edge.
